As the temperatures begin to rise, the stories on soaps are getting hotter. In this new monthly feature, we’ll preview the romantic moments you can’t miss. Check out what’s coming up in May on every show.

Beyond the Gates

Kat Richardson (Colby Muhammad) witnesses an intimate moment that could change her life.

Dani Dupree (Karla Mosley) reignites a forbidden flame and finally defines the line between sex and something more.

Kat lets her guard down with Tomas Navarro (Alex Alegria).

Hayley Lawson (Marquita Goings) raises the stakes in her marriage to Bill Hamilton (Timon Kyle Durrett).

Ted Richardson (Keith D. Robinson) learns about a secret love affair.

Days of Our Lives

Xander Kiriakis (Paul Telfer) and Sarah Horton (Linsey Godfrey) share a romantic moment, until she passes out.

Hope Williams Brady (Kristian Alfonso) reminisces with comatose and fading Bo Brady (Peter Reckell) on their 40th wedding anniversary.

Julie Williams (Susan Seaforth Hayes) prays to Doug Williams in heaven to help Bo.

General Hospital

Jack Brennan (Chris McKenna) conveys to Carly Spencer (Laura Wright) how much she means to him.

Cody Bell (Josh Kelly) and Molly Lansing (Kristen Vaganos) are mistaken for a couple.

Willow Tait (Katelyn MacMullen) declares her love for Drew Quartermaine (Cameron Mathison).

Jordan Ashford (Tanisha Harper) and Isaiah Gannon (Sawandi Wilson) share a bittersweet moment.

Ric Lansing (Rick Hearst) and Liz Webber (Rebecca Herbst) enjoy a meal together.

The Bold and the Beautiful

Carter Walton (Lawrence Saint-Victor) fights for the one he loves.

Will Spencer (Crew Morrow) wants to take his relationship with Electra Forrester (Laneya Grace) to the next level.

Liam Spencer’s (Scott Clifton) illness brings Steffy Forrester (Jacqueline MacInnes Wood) and Hope Logan (Annika Noelle) together.

The Young and the Restless

Claire Grace (Hayley Erin) and Kyle Abbott (Michael Mealor) come up with a plan to win Victor Newman’s (Eric Braeden) approval of their relationship.

Amanda Sinclair (Mishael Morgan) returns to town. Will old feelings resurface between Amanda and Devon Winters (Bryton James)?

Mariah Copeland (Camryn Grimes) and Tessa Porter’s (Cait Fairbanks) marriage is tested when a secret of Mariah’s challenges their relationship.

On May 21, look for a special episode devoted to romance, focused on three of Y&R’s most enduring couples:

Victor Newman (Eric Braeden) and Nikki Newman (Melody Thomas Scott) celebrate their love story and share a hope their loved ones will one day have their own success with love.

Michael Baldwin (Christian J. LeBlanc) proves to Lauren Fenmore (Tracey E. Bregman) that nothing is more important than their relationship.

Jack Abbott (Peter Bergman) surprises Diane Jenkins (Susan Walters) with a special gift to show his appreciation for her work on the Abbott manse renovation.
